Elena Rybakina vs Belinda Bencic H2H: 1-1
Elena Rybakina and Belinda Bencic are tied 1–1 in their WTA head-to-head. Across 2 main-draw meetings, they are tied 1–1 on hard courts. Most recently, Belinda Bencic won the 2025 Abu Dhabi semifinal 3-6 6-3 6-4.

H2H Match Log
| Date | Tournament | Category | Round | Surface | Winner | Score | Loser | Match |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Feb 7, 2025 | Abu Dhabi | WTA 500 | SF | Hard | Belinda Bencic | 3-6 6-3 6-4 | Elena Rybakina | Match data |
| Oct 2, 2021* | Chicago 2 | WTA 500 | QF | Hard | Elena Rybakina | 6-4 3-1 | Belinda Bencic | Match data |
* Estimated match date where the exact historical date is unavailable.
